posts - 0,  comments - 20,  trackbacks - 0
原文:http://www.okpython.com/views-tid-1607.html

1.系统要求
Win2k、Winxp或Win2003操作系统

2.软件列表

apache_2.0.58-win32-x86-no_ssl.msi
php-5.1.4-Win32
mysql-4.1.20-win32.zip
ZendFramework-0.1.5.zip

开始安装:

  一.安装Apache,全部选择默认安装后,打开浏览器:http://localhost/,如显示Apache迎页面则安装成功。
  二.将php-5.1.4-Win32.zip解压到C:\PHP目录下,然后把”php.ini-dist:”重命名为”php.ini”,很多文章都讲的是要把php.ini复制到C:\Windows或C:\Winnt目录下,其实复不复制都可以。

Apache的配置:

编辑httpd.conf文件
首先找到DirectoryIndex index.html index.html.var 并更改为
DirectoryIndex index.php index.html index.htm index.html.var,这样才能让 Apache找到首页
再找到 将DocumentRoot “C:\Program files\Apache Groiup\Apache2\htdocs” 更改为你的目录。

然后找到

LoadModule rewrite_module modules/mod_rewrite.so 这行并将前面的”
”去掉,因为要使用Zend Framework就必须这样,至少现在如此。

在文件末尾加上以下几行:(根据自己的情况更改路径)
ScriptAlias /php/ "C:/PHP/"
AddType application/x-httpd-php .php
Action application/x-httpd-php "/php/php-cgi.exe"
这样才能正常运行PHP5程序
最后找到
AllowOverride None
更改为:
AllowOverride All,才能让/htaccess文件起作用
到此Apache的配置完成

重新启动Apache服务器,编辑index.php如下:


代码片段
phpinfo();
?>

放到你的网站根目录里,打开浏览器并输入:http://localhost回车,如出现PHP基本配置信息则说明配置成功,继续下一步。



三.安装MySQL


全部默认安装即可。



四.

将ZendFramework-0.1.5.zip解压到一个目录(我这里是C:\ZendFramework-0.1.5)

配置php.ini文件:
因为我们没有安装PDO模块,所以现在必须安装,将C:\PHP\ext目录下的php_mysql.dll、php_mysqli.dll、php_pdo.dll、php_pdo_mysql.dll 和C:\PHP目录下的libmysql.dll、php5ts.dll几个文件复制到系统目录下,即C:\Windows\system32或C:\Winnt\system32。其实只要是dll都可以复制。然找到
;extension=php_mysql.dll
;extension=php_pdo.dll
;extension=php_pdo_mysql.dll
这几行并将前面的分号去掉
最后再找到:
;include_path=".;C:\PHP\pear;c:\php\includes "将前面的分号去掉并更改为
include_path=".;C:\PHP\pear;c:\php\includes ;C:\ZendFramework-0.1.5\library",注意C前面加了个分号。
最后编辑文件.htaccess如下:
RewriteEngine on
RewriteRule !\.(js|ico|gif|jpg|png|css)$ index.php并放到网站根目录。

到此为止,所有的配置完成。在下也是初学者,错误在所难免,请多指教。
posted on 2009-12-09 12:35 Documents 阅读(747) 评论(0)  编辑  收藏 所属分类: LinuxZendFramework

只有注册用户登录后才能发表评论。


网站导航:
 
<2024年12月>
24252627282930
1234567
891011121314
15161718192021
22232425262728
2930311234

留言簿

文章分类

文章档案

J2EE

搜索

  •  

最新评论